  1. Protective role of lignan-converting bacteria on chemically-induced breast cancer in gnotobiotic rats

    Enterolignans (enterodiol and enterolactone) exhibit structural similarity to estradiol and have therefore been hypothesized to modulate hormone related cancers such as breast cancer. The bioactivation of the plant lignan secoisolariciresinol diglucoside (SDG) requires the transformation by …
